Duma rules on time and IWM
Just so you know, when I give a time, it is always eastern. All the clocks in my office and my computer are set to eastern.
When I talk bars I always use the ending time of the bar. So if I say a 12pm bar, that is the bar that ends at 12pm. That way the time of trade and the bar that gave the signal match. I know that SC uses the beginning time for their labeling, so it can be messy.
I always give the trading results based on trading IWM. I actually trade UWM. If I invest 75% of my funds than I am trading at 150% of assets. If you are investing 100% of your funds in 3x funds, that is confidence. I just don't have that much yet.
If you want to report central and beginning bar time, just let me know and I will adjust your numbers in my head.

Duma Trading Rules
Rules for Trading SR60AT- Stochastic and RSI on 60min chart trading at end of any completed bar
I use FreeStockCharts.com and Stock Charts for my graphing. Both of these use 9:30-10am as the 30min bar of the day. FSC labels their bars with the ending time and SC uses the beginning time. All of my discussion and reporting is based on bar ending times (FSC), because that is the actual time. A 10am bar trades at 10am.
Another key difference is RSI, in FSC it is called Wilder RSI.
OB stands for over bought and OS stands for over sold
I use just two indicators. Stochastic(14,3,3) and RSI(14)
BASIC TRADING
The basic long trade is when both indicators are OS and both break above the OS limits, stoc>20 and RSI>40.
The basic short trade is when both indicators are OB and both fall below the OB limits, stoc<80 and RSI<60.
If prices don't cross the outer limits before reversing, then I resort to %k and %D cross overs and RSI slope. I normally like to see a two bar slope change in RSI. One bar price dips are common and will often whip if traded.
OTHER CONSIDERATIONS
Whenever I get a trade signal, I switch to a 3min chart to determine the short term trend. If it is reverse to the direction I want to trade, I will wait to trade until I get a stochastic(33,10,10) cross. Otherwise I will usually execute with a buy stop with a few ticks margin or the high/low of the signal bar. I am giving up a few ticks in gain, but well worth the safety. It appears to me that many algo programs kick in on the hour and reversals are common at hour points. If the reverse has been slow in coming and looks firm I may just trade at the signal price and use a stop. If nothing else just wait 1 or 2 minutes after the signal to see how the new hour starts before executing.
I usually use the open or close of the signal bar as a sell stop after execution. At times I use a -.35% or -.5% stop. It all just depends on the situation. I consider the size of the signal bar ( tall, short), recent volatility, mood of the day.
I never trade based on a 3pm bar at 3pm. I wait until the 10am bar is printed the next day. Too many weird things go on during the close and open. This gives the market 30min into the new day to settle down.
These are my basic rules. I discuss every trade, so as new situations come up that are worth making noting, I will add. The market is ever changing and we have to change with it.
